Gluten safety, certifications, and suitability

The product title states gluten-free, and the ingredient is a single spice with no other ingredients listed. However, no external gluten-free certification (e.g., GFCO/NSF) is disclosed, and there is no facility or cross-contact information provided. The gluten-safety assessment notes the labeling as likely safe for celiac adherence, but highlights the absence of certification or cross-contact details as a point of uncertainty. Based on this evidence, the product is likely safe for many gluten-sensitive individuals who rely on labeling, but strict celiac users or those needing explicit cross-contact disclosures may require additional information before purchase.
